Revolutionizing Chatbots: Unveiling the Power of Natural Language Processing in ChatGPT

Introduction:

What is Natural Language Processing? Natural Language Processing (NLP) is a branch of artificial intelligence that focuses on the interaction between computers and human language. It aims to enable computers to understand, interpret, and respond to human language in a way that is both meaningful and contextually appropriate. NLP encompasses a wide range of tasks, including language translation, sentiment analysis, speech recognition, and chatbot development.

The Rise of Chatbots: In recent years, chatbots have become increasingly popular as a means of providing automated customer support, generating leads, and enhancing user experience. Chatbots are computer programs designed to simulate human conversation, using NLP techniques to process and respond to user queries or prompts. They can be deployed across various platforms, including websites, messaging apps, and social media platforms, to engage with users in a conversational manner.

Challenges in Chatbot Development: Creating effective chatbots presents several challenges. One of the main hurdles lies in building chatbots that can understand and respond to a wide array of user inputs. Human language is incredibly diverse, with variations in syntax, grammar, dialects, and informal speech. Handling these variations and ensuring accurate understanding is essential for successful chatbot interactions.

Introducing ChatGPT: ChatGPT is a state-of-the-art chatbot model developed by OpenAI. Building on the success of models like GPT-3, ChatGPT leverages the power of deep learning and NLP to deliver more intuitive and human-like conversations. It is trained using a vast amount of data, including internet text, and learns to generate responses based on the context and input provided by the user.

Understanding Context: One of the key strengths of ChatGPT is its ability to understand and maintain context during conversations. It can remember and refer back to previous parts of the conversation, allowing for more coherent and contextually appropriate responses. This contextual understanding enables ChatGPT to have more meaningful and engaging interactions with users, enhancing the overall user experience.

Generating Coherent Responses: ChatGPT excels at generating responses that are coherent and logically connected to the user’s input. Through its extensive training, it learns to generate responses that are contextually relevant and follow a logical flow. This ensures that the chatbot’s output is not only grammatically correct but also makes sense in the given context. By avoiding irrelevant or nonsensical responses, ChatGPT creates a more human-like conversation.

Handling Ambiguity and Uncertainty: Ambiguity and uncertainty are common aspects of human language that can pose challenges for chatbot interactions. ChatGPT tackles this by providing clarifying questions when it encounters ambiguous user inputs. Rather than guessing the user’s intent, the chatbot seeks clarification and offers suggestions to ensure accurate understanding. This ability to handle ambiguity makes ChatGPT more robust and adaptable in different conversational scenarios.

Applications of ChatGPT: ChatGPT has the potential to transform various industries with its powerful NLP capabilities. Some of its potential applications include customer support, educational assistance, content generation, language translation, and personal assistants. These applications can significantly improve efficiency, accessibility, and user experience in various domains.

Challenges and Ethical Considerations: While ChatGPT offers significant advancements in chatbot technology, there are important challenges and ethical considerations to address. These include bias in language and responses, potential misuse and manipulation, and user privacy and data protection. Addressing these challenges requires ongoing monitoring, user authentication, content moderation, and robust data protection measures.

You May Also Like to Read  Unveiling the Potential of ChatGPT: Paving the Way for the Future of Conversations

The Future of Chatbots and NLP: The development of models like ChatGPT represents a major step forward in the evolution of chatbot technology. As NLP continues to advance, we can expect even smarter and more human-like chatbots with enhanced conversational abilities. The future lies in refining understanding of user intent, addressing nuanced context, and improving response coherence. Continued collaboration between researchers, developers, and stakeholders is crucial in addressing challenges and ensuring responsible deployment of chatbot technology.

Full Article: Revolutionizing Chatbots: Unveiling the Power of Natural Language Processing in ChatGPT

What is Natural Language Processing?

Natural Language Processing (NLP) is a branch of artificial intelligence that focuses on the interaction between computers and human language. It aims to enable computers to understand, interpret, and respond to human language in a way that is both meaningful and contextually appropriate. NLP encompasses a wide range of tasks, including language translation, sentiment analysis, speech recognition, and chatbot development.

The Rise of Chatbots

In recent years, chatbots have become increasingly popular as a means of providing automated customer support, generating leads, and enhancing user experience. Chatbots are computer programs designed to simulate human conversation, using NLP techniques to process and respond to user queries or prompts. They can be deployed across various platforms, including websites, messaging apps, and social media platforms, to engage with users in a conversational manner.

Challenges in Chatbot Development

Creating effective chatbots presents several challenges. One of the main hurdles lies in building chatbots that can understand and respond to a wide array of user inputs. Human language is incredibly diverse, with variations in syntax, grammar, dialects, and informal speech. Handling these variations and ensuring accurate understanding is essential for successful chatbot interactions.

Another challenge is the need for chatbots to exhibit a level of naturalness and conversational flow that mimics human conversation. This involves not only understanding the user’s intent but also generating responses that are contextually relevant, coherent, and engaging. Achieving this level of conversational quality requires advanced NLP capabilities.

Introducing ChatGPT

ChatGPT is a state-of-the-art chatbot model developed by OpenAI. Building on the success of models like GPT-3, ChatGPT leverages the power of deep learning and NLP to deliver more intuitive and human-like conversations. It is trained using a vast amount of data, including internet text, and learns to generate responses based on the context and input provided by the user.

Understanding Context

One of the key strengths of ChatGPT is its ability to understand and maintain context during conversations. It can remember and refer back to previous parts of the conversation, allowing for more coherent and contextually appropriate responses. This contextual understanding enables ChatGPT to have more meaningful and engaging interactions with users, enhancing the overall user experience.

Generating Coherent Responses

ChatGPT excels at generating responses that are coherent and logically connected to the user’s input. Through its extensive training, it learns to generate responses that are contextually relevant and follow a logical flow. This ensures that the chatbot’s output is not only grammatically correct but also makes sense in the given context. By avoiding irrelevant or nonsensical responses, ChatGPT creates a more human-like conversation.

Handling Ambiguity and Uncertainty

Ambiguity and uncertainty are common aspects of human language that can pose challenges for chatbot interactions. ChatGPT tackles this by providing clarifying questions when it encounters ambiguous user inputs. Rather than guessing the user’s intent, the chatbot seeks clarification and offers suggestions to ensure accurate understanding. This ability to handle ambiguity makes ChatGPT more robust and adaptable in different conversational scenarios.

You May Also Like to Read  Discovering the Enigma of ChatGPT: Revealing the Algorithm Powering Authentic Conversations in Natural Language

Applications of ChatGPT

ChatGPT has the potential to transform various industries with its powerful NLP capabilities. Some of its potential applications include:

Customer Support

ChatGPT can be deployed as a virtual customer support agent, automating responses to common inquiries and addressing customer concerns. Its ability to provide accurate and contextually appropriate answers can significantly reduce the workload of human support teams and improve response times.

Educational Assistance

ChatGPT can serve as a virtual tutor, providing users with personalized and interactive educational experiences. It can answer questions, explain complex concepts, and guide users through learning materials. This enables scalable and accessible educational support, particularly in areas where access to teachers or tutors is limited.

Content Generation

With its natural language generation capabilities, ChatGPT can assist in content creation. It can help automate the writing of articles, blog posts, product descriptions, and various other forms of content. This can save time for content creators and enable them to focus on higher-level tasks, such as strategy and creativity.

Language Translation

Language barriers can hinder global communication and collaboration. ChatGPT can be used to develop chatbots that offer real-time language translation, facilitating smooth conversations between individuals who speak different languages. This has the potential to open up new opportunities for international business and cultural exchange.

Personal Assistants

ChatGPT can be integrated into personal assistant applications, providing users with a conversational interface to interact with their devices. It can assist with tasks such as scheduling appointments, setting reminders, and searching for information, all through natural conversation. This enhances the user experience, making personal assistants more intuitive and user-friendly.

Challenges and Ethical Considerations

While ChatGPT offers significant advancements in chatbot technology, there are important challenges and ethical considerations to address:

Bias in Language and Responses

As chatbot models learn from vast amounts of internet text, they may inadvertently absorb biases present in the data. This can lead to biased language generation and partial or inaccurate responses. Addressing bias in chatbot models requires careful training data curation and ongoing monitoring to ensure fairness and inclusivity in their outputs.

Potential Misuse and Manipulation

With the increasing sophistication of chatbots, there is a risk of malicious actors misusing or manipulating them to spread misinformation, engage in social engineering, or amplify harmful ideologies. Developers and users must be vigilant in detecting and preventing such misuse, incorporating measures for user authentication and content moderation.

User Privacy and Data Protection

Chatbots often require access to personal information to provide personalized experiences. It is crucial to establish robust data protection measures to safeguard user privacy and ensure compliance with relevant data protection regulations. This includes anonymizing and securely storing user data and obtaining explicit user consent for data collection and usage.

The Future of Chatbots and NLP

The development of models like ChatGPT represents a major step forward in the evolution of chatbot technology. As NLP continues to advance, we can expect even smarter and more human-like chatbots with enhanced conversational abilities.

The key to the future of chatbots lies in refining their understanding of user intent, addressing nuanced context, and improving response coherence. Future models may incorporate multimodal inputs, such as images or videos, to enable more interactive and engaging conversations. Integration with other emerging technologies, such as augmented reality and virtual reality, may further enhance the capabilities and user experience of chatbots.

You May Also Like to Read  Understanding the Language Model of OpenAI: Unveiling the Evolution of ChatGPT

Furthermore, continued collaboration between researchers, developers, and stakeholders will be essential in addressing the challenges and ethical considerations associated with NLP and chatbot development. This collaboration can ensure that the benefits of chatbot technology are harnessed responsibly, promoting inclusivity, fairness, and user privacy.

In conclusion, ChatGPT and other advanced NLP models are paving the way for smarter chatbots that can understand and interact with users more naturally. These chatbots have the potential to revolutionize various industries by providing efficient customer support, personalized education, automated content generation, and improved language translation. However, it is crucial to address challenges related to bias, misuse, and privacy to ensure the responsible deployment of chatbots. With further advancements and ethical considerations, the future holds exciting possibilities for NLP and chatbot technology.

Summary: Revolutionizing Chatbots: Unveiling the Power of Natural Language Processing in ChatGPT

Natural Language Processing (NLP) is a branch of AI that enables computers to understand and respond to human language. Chatbots, powered by NLP, have gained popularity in providing automated customer support and enhancing user experience. However, developing effective chatbots poses challenges in understanding diverse user inputs and generating natural responses. Introducing ChatGPT, a state-of-the-art chatbot model by OpenAI, addresses these challenges. ChatGPT excels in maintaining context, generating coherent responses, and handling ambiguity. Its potential applications include customer support, educational assistance, content generation, language translation, and personal assistants. Nevertheless, ethical considerations regarding bias, misuse, and privacy must be addressed. The future holds promises of smarter chatbots through advancements in NLP and collaboration with stakeholders.

Frequently Asked Questions:

Q1: What is ChatGPT?
A1: ChatGPT is an advanced language model developed by OpenAI. It is designed to engage in meaningful conversations and provides human-like responses. It uses deep learning techniques to understand and generate text, making it an ideal platform for natural language processing tasks.

Q2: How does ChatGPT work?
A2: ChatGPT utilizes a neural network architecture called a transformer, which is trained on a vast amount of text data. This allows the model to learn grammar, context, and syntax patterns, enabling it to generate coherent responses. It employs a machine learning approach known as unsupervised learning, which allows it to adapt and improve through continuous exposure to data.

Q3: Can ChatGPT understand multiple languages?
A A3: Yes, ChatGPT can understand and generate text in multiple languages. However, its proficiency and accuracy may be higher in languages for which it has been trained extensively. OpenAI is actively working on expanding its language support and enhancing its performance for various languages.

Q4: Does ChatGPT have any limitations?
A4: While ChatGPT is an impressive language model, it has limitations. It may occasionally produce incorrect or nonsensical answers. It can be sensitive to input phrasing, and slight modifications to a question may yield different responses. It may also respond with confidence even when uncertain about the answer. OpenAI is actively working to improve these limitations and encourages users to provide feedback to help uncover and address any issues.

Q5: What can I use ChatGPT for?
A5: ChatGPT can be used for a wide range of applications. It can assist in drafting emails, answering questions, creating conversational agents, providing tutoring, coding assistance, and much more. Its versatility allows individuals and businesses to leverage it for numerous natural language processing tasks, unlocking creative and innovative possibilities in various domains.

Please note that while ChatGPT strives to provide accurate and helpful answers, it should not be solely relied upon for critical or sensitive information. It is always advisable to verify important details independently.